The amendments were passed in a special legislative session as part of a <a href=\"https:\/\/www.revisor.mn.gov\/laws\/2025\/1\/Session+Law\/Chapter\/6\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">budget measure<\/a>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ong><mark style=\"background-color:rgba(0, 0, 0, 0);color:#a41919\" class=\"has-inline-color\">Read more<\/mark><\/strong>: <a href=\"https:\/\/www.employco.com\/PDFs\/July2025_4-Minnesota.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Minnesota Legal Update<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:10px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-group\"><div class=\"wp-block-group__inner-container is-layout-constrained wp-block-group-is-layout-constrained\"><div class=\"wp-block-ub-divider ub_divider ub-divider-orientation-horizontal\" id=\"ub_divider_f69d4678-fa05-4173-9999-c5a85befd820\"><div class=\"ub_divider_wrapper\" style=\"position: relative; margin-bottom: 2px; width: 100%; height: 2px; \" data-divider-alignment=\"center\"><div class=\"ub_divider_line\" style=\"border-top: 2px solid #000000; margin-top: 2px; \"><\/div><\/div><\/div>\n\n\n<div style=\"height:25px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>New York City Amends Paid Sick Leave Rules for Prenatal Leave<\/strong> &#8211; New York City has <a href=\"https:\/\/rules.cityofnewyork.us\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/06\/DCWP-NOA-Paid-Prenatal-Personal-Leave-Final.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">amended<\/a> its rules for the city\u2019s Earned Safe and Sick Time Act (ESSTA) to incorporate the state law <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ny.gov\/programs\/new-york-state-paid-prenatal-leave\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">paid<\/a> prenatal leave requirement that took effect Jan. 1, 2025. The city\u2019s new rules differ from the state-paid prenatal leave requirements with respect to employers\u2019 written policies, employees\u2019 notification of the need for leave, documentation of leave, and penalties for violations. The city also issued an updated paid safe and sick time <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nyc.gov\/assets\/dca\/downloads\/pdf\/about\/PaidSafeSickLeave-MandatoryNotice-English.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">notice<\/a> for employer use. The amendments to the ESSTA rules take effect July 2, 2025.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ong><mark style=\"background-color:rgba(0, 0, 0, 0);color:#a41919\" class=\"has-inline-color\">Read more<\/mark><\/strong>: <a href=\"https:\/\/www.employco.com\/PDFs\/July2025_5-New-York.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">New York Legal Update<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:10px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n<\/div><\/div>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-group\"><div class=\"wp-block-group__inner-container is-layout-constrained wp-block-group-is-layout-constrained\"><div class=\"wp-block-ub-divider ub_divider ub-divider-orientation-horizontal\" id=\"ub_divider_ecc437d0-9988-4158-9b67-84fda61382f9\"><div class=\"ub_divider_wrapper\" style=\"position: relative; margin-bottom: 2px; width: 100%; height: 2px; \" data-divider-alignment=\"center\"><div class=\"ub_divider_line\" style=\"border-top: 2px solid #000000; margin-top: 2px; \"><\/div><\/div><\/div>\n\n\n<div style=\"height:25px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>New York Increases Jury Duty Pay<\/strong> &#8211; As part of the 2025-26 budget bill, New York <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nysenate.gov\/legislation\/laws\/JUD\/521\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">amended<\/a> its judiciary law to increase the daily allowance for jurors to $72 from $40 per day for New York state, town, and village courts. Key changes address leave to care for children, return-to-work certifications, and qualified reasons for paid family and medical leave.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ong><mark style=\"background-color:rgba(0, 0, 0, 0);color:#a41919\" class=\"has-inline-color\">Read more<\/mark><\/strong>: <a href=\"https:\/\/www.employco.com\/PDFs\/July2025_8-Oregon.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Oregon Legal Update<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:10px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n<\/div><\/div>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-group\"><div class=\"wp-block-group__inner-container is-layout-constrained wp-block-group-is-layout-constrained\"><div class=\"wp-block-ub-divider ub_divider ub-divider-orientation-horizontal\" id=\"ub_divider_08d0c5f2-bb9a-4744-8fe5-8bb58dc961c1\"><div class=\"ub_divider_wrapper\" style=\"position: relative; margin-bottom: 2px; width: 100%; height: 2px; \" data-divider-alignment=\"center\"><div class=\"ub_divider_line\" style=\"border-top: 2px solid #000000; margin-top: 2px; \"><\/div><\/div><\/div>\n\n\n<div style=\"height:25px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Vermont Expands Parental and Family Leave<\/strong> &#8211; Vermont has enacted <a href=\"https:\/\/legislature.vermont.gov\/Documents\/2026\/Docs\/ACTS\/ACT032\/ACT032%20As%20Enacted.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">H. 461<\/a>, a bill that significantly amends the state\u2019s Parental and Family Leave Act (PFLA), which provides unpaid employee leave for family care purposes. Among other changes, the bill includes a definition of \u201cfamily member\u201d and adds coverage for safe leave, bereavement leave, and military exigency leave. The bill also makes recovery from childbirth and miscarriage covered events. The amendments take effect July 1.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ong><mark style=\"background-color:rgba(0, 0, 0, 0);color:#a41919\" class=\"has-inline-color\">Read more<\/mark><\/strong>: <a href=\"https:\/\/www.employco.com\/PDFs\/July2025_9-Vermont.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Vermont Legal Update<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:10px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n<\/div><\/div>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-group\"><div class=\"wp-block-group__inner-container is-layout-constrained wp-block-group-is-layout-constrained\"><div class=\"wp-block-ub-divider ub_divider ub-divider-orientation-horizontal\" id=\"ub_divider_b4f95aab-f1d5-4e8f-b129-f9db5544f3a5\"><div class=\"ub_divider_wrapper\" style=\"position: relative; margin-bottom: 2px; width: 100%; height: 2px; \" data-divider-alignment=\"center\"><div class=\"ub_divider_line\" style=\"border-top: 2px solid #000000; margin-top: 2px; \"><\/div><\/div><\/div>\n\n\n<div style=\"height:25px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Washington Amends PFML to Limit Stacking, Expand Job Protection<\/strong> &#8211; Washington state has passed amendments to its paid family and medical leave (PFML) program.
